about summary refs log tree commit diff
path: root/src/bootstrap
AgeCommit message (Expand)AuthorLines
2021-08-03Add x.py option to --force-rerun compiletest testsSmitty-0/+17
2021-08-02Auto merge of #87297 - ZuseZ4:new_build_flags, r=Mark-Simulacrumbors-0/+18
2021-08-02Auto merge of #87535 - lf-:authors, r=Mark-Simulacrumbors-1/+0
2021-08-02Rollup merge of #87282 - pietroalbini:refactor-extended, r=Mark-SimulacrumYuki Okushi-135/+154
2021-07-31add two new build flags to build clang and enable llvm pluginsManuel Drehwald-0/+18
2021-07-31netbsd x86_64 arch enable supported sanitizers.David Carlier-0/+3
2021-07-29rfc3052: Remove authors field from Cargo manifestsJade-1/+0
2021-07-28set all of the optional tools as DEFAULT = truePietro Albini-0/+9
2021-07-28Rollup merge of #87513 - hudson-ayers:bootstrap-py-fix, r=jyn514Yuki Okushi-1/+1
2021-07-28Rollup merge of #87443 - jyn514:submodules-take-n, r=jyn514Yuki Okushi-18/+37
2021-07-27boostrap.py: only look for merges by borsTaylor Yu-3/+6
2021-07-27bootstrap.py: use `git rev-list` for robustnessTaylor Yu-4/+5
2021-07-27bootstrap.py: remove unused `git log` optionHudson Ayers-1/+1
2021-07-25Don't treat git repos as non-existent when `ignore_git` is setJoshua Nelson-18/+37
2021-07-24Rollup merge of #87370 - pkubaj:master, r=oli-obkManish Goregaokar-0/+9
2021-07-24Rollup merge of #87412 - r00ster91:patch-13, r=Mark-SimulacrumYuki Okushi-1/+1
2021-07-24Rollup merge of #87380 - jyn514:smarter-submodule-defaults, r=Mark-SimulacrumYuki Okushi-5/+10
2021-07-24Rollup merge of #87358 - jyn514:dry-run, r=Mark-SimulacrumYuki Okushi-2/+10
2021-07-24Rollup merge of #87283 - pietroalbini:configure-codegen-backends, r=Mark-Simu...Yuki Okushi-0/+3
2021-07-24Rollup merge of #87191 - adamgemmell:dev/llvm-lib-package, r=Mark-SimulacrumYuki Okushi-1/+9
2021-07-24Rollup merge of #87185 - waterlens:issue-86499-fix, r=Mark-SimulacrumYuki Okushi-6/+14
2021-07-23Add missing articler00ster-1/+1
2021-07-23refactor extended tarball generaton to use the new ensure_if_defaultPietro Albini-38/+55
2021-07-23don't build extra tools if build.tools is explicitly an empty listPietro Albini-6/+1
2021-07-23Rollup merge of #87362 - inquisitivecrystal:bootstrap-doc, r=jyn514Yuki Okushi-4/+5
2021-07-22Don't default to `submodules = true` unless the rust repo has a .git directoryJoshua Nelson-5/+10
2021-07-22Add support for powerpc-unknown-freebsdPiotr Kubaj-0/+9
2021-07-21Make `x.py d` an alias for `x.py doc`inquisitivecrystal-4/+5
2021-07-22Fix `--dry-run` when download-ci-llvm is setJoshua Nelson-2/+10
2021-07-21Remove cargo workspace to build rustdoc-gui test crates because of cargo conf...Guillaume Gomez-11/+20
2021-07-21Rollup merge of #87301 - chinmaydd:chinmaydd-patch-1-1, r=jyn514Guillaume Gomez-1/+1
2021-07-21Rollup merge of #87187 - oxalica:fix-nixos-detect, r=nagisaGuillaume Gomez-1/+7
2021-07-21Auto merge of #82653 - jyn514:submodules-on-demand, r=Mark-Simulacrumbors-113/+173
2021-07-20Update all submodules that rustbuild doesn't depend on lazilyJoshua Nelson-113/+173
2021-07-21Fix NixOS detectionoxalica-1/+7
2021-07-19Fix typo in compile.rsChinmay Deshpande-1/+1
2021-07-19add --codegen-backends=foo,bar ./configure flagPietro Albini-0/+3
2021-07-19refactor gating of mingwPietro Albini-6/+4
2021-07-19refactor gating of demanglerPietro Albini-24/+26
2021-07-19refactor gating of toolsPietro Albini-74/+75
2021-07-19change output of dist cargo and clippy to be consistent with other toolsPietro Albini-10/+14
2021-07-19refactor gating of dist docsPietro Albini-18/+11
2021-07-19refactor adding rustc and std into extended buildsPietro Albini-9/+9
2021-07-16Package LLVM libs for the target rather than the build hostAdam Gemmell-1/+9
2021-07-16Fix panics on Windows when the build was cancelledwaterlens-6/+14
2021-07-13Upgrade `cc` crate to 1.0.69Yuki Okushi-1/+1
2021-07-13Rollup merge of #87035 - GuillaumeGomez:fix-implementors-display, r=notriddleYuki Okushi-14/+12
2021-07-13Rollup merge of #87007 - ehuss:fix-rust-analyzer-install, r=Mark-SimulacrumYuki Okushi-6/+19
2021-07-12Provide a better error when `x.py install src/doc` doesn't work.Eric Huss-4/+6
2021-07-12Simplify build system for rustdoc-gui test cratesGuillaume Gomez-14/+12